Materials

Special stitches

Fpdc- Front post double crochet

Fptr- Front post treble crochet  

Pants

Legs(make 2) 
R1​: Ch 12. Sc into first ch making sure that you do not twist the ch. Sc into next 11ch. (12)

R2​: Sc into the first sc. sc around (12)

R3-19​: Sc around (12) First leg only-​ cut yarn and fasten off.

Joining legs 
R20​: Ch1 on the second leg then sc into the first leg. 11 sc around the top of the first leg. Ch1 and sc into the next st of the second leg. 11 sc around the top of the second leg. (24 sc, 2 ch)

R21​: *Sc into the ch1 sp. 12 sc* Repeat ** (26)

R22-26​: Sc in each st around. (26)

Sl st into the next st. Cut yarn and fasten off. Weave in all ends. Sew the crotch closed.

Sweater 

Make sure to keep the stitches nice and loose on the ribbed border.  

Ribbed Border 

R1​: With pink, ch4. Sc into second ch from hook. Sc into the next 2 ch. Turn (do not ch1) (3)

R2​: Sl st across. Ch1, turn (3)

R3​: Sc across. Turn (3)

R4-39​: Repeat R2-3 (3)

Form a ring by making a sl st into both the bottom of R1 and the blo of R39. Make sure you do not twist the fabric.

Torso 

R1​: 21 sc spaced evenly across the top of the ring formed by R1-39. Ch1, turn (21)

R2-10​. Sc in each st across. Ch1, turn (21)

R11​: 3sc then ch6. Sk 3 st then 9 sc. Ch6. Sk 3 st. 3 sc. Ch1, turn. (15 sc, 12 ch)

R12​: Sc then sc dec. Make 4 sc into the ch 6 sp. Sc dec. Make 5 sc. Sc dec. 4 sc into the ch 6 sp. Sc dec, sc. Ch 1, turn. (19)

R13​: Sc. 3 sc dec. Make 5 sc, then 3 sc dec. Sc. Ch 1, turn. (13) R14​: 3 sc dec. Sc. 3 sc dec (7)

Cut yarn and fasten off.

Collar   

R1​: Ch 3. Sc in second ch from hook. Sc. Turn (2)

R2​: Sl st across. Ch1, turn (2)

R3​: Sc across. Turn (2)

R4-25​:Repeat R2-3

Cut yarn and fasten off. Leave a long tail for sewing.

Sew on the collar so that when you fold the collar down, the ribbing is facing out. The collar will be a little bit longer than the neck opening. Just scrunch up the collar a little bit as you sew it on to get it to fit.

Sleeves 

For both arms-

R1​: Make a standing sc into the arm-hole. Make 10 sc evenly spaced around the opening. (11)

R2​: Sc into the standing sc. Sc around. (11)

R3-14​: Sc around. (11)

Sl st into the next sc. Cut yarn and fasten off.

Cuffs 

Make 2

R1​: Ch4. Sc into the second ch from hook. Sc across. Turn. (3)

R2​: Sl st across. Ch1, turn. (3)

R3​: Sc across. Turn. (3)

R4-15​: Repeat R2-3

Form a ring by *Sl st into both R1 and the blo of R15* Repeat** across.

Cut yarn and fasten off. Leave a long tail for sewing. Sew the cuff onto the arm of the sweater.

Sew the loose flap of the collar down to the body of the sweater.

Button holes   

Join yarn using standing sc to the bottom left of the V on the back. 2 Sc. Ch3. sk st (buttonhole made) *3 sc. Ch 3. Sk st.* Repeat **once then 2 sc. (10 sc, 9 ch)

Cut yarn and fasten off. Weave in all ends.

Sew on 3 buttons across from the buttonholes.

Shoes 

Make 2

R1​: With brown, 5 sc into a magic ring (5)

R2​: 2 sc in each st around (10)

R3-4​: sc around (10)

R5​: Sc into next 6 st. Ch 1, turn (6)

R6-8​: Sc in each st across. Ch1, turn (6)

Cut yarn and fasten off. Leaving a long tail for sewing.

Sew up the heel of the shoe by folding the flap in half and sewing row 8 together.

R1​: Join yarn to the top of the opening with a standing sc. Sc 13 times around the opening (14)

R2​: Sc into the standing sc. Sc around (14)

R3-8​: Sc around. (14)

Sl st into the next st. Cut yarn and fasten off.

Bag

R1​: Ch 11. Sc in second ch from hook. Sc across. Ch1, turn. (10)

R2​: Sc across. Ch1, turn. (10)

R3​: 4 sc. Fpdc around the 5th and 6th st from R1. Ch1, turn. (10)

R4​: Sc across. Ch1, turn. (10)

R5​: 4 sc. Fptr around the 2nd fpdc of R3. Fptr around the 1st fpdc of R3. (This st will be behind the st you just made. ) 4 sc. Ch1, turn. (10)

R6​: Sc across. Ch1, turn. (10)

R7​: 4 sc. Fptr around the 2nd fptr from two rows before. Fptr around the 1st fptr from two rows before. 4 sc. Ch1, turn. (10)

R8-21​: Repeat R6-7. (10)

Cut yarn and fasten off.

Handle 

R1​: Ch 45. Sc in second ch from hook. Sc into each ch. Ch1, turn. (44)

R2​: Sc across. (44)

Cut yarn and fasten off, leaving a long tail for sewing

Fold the bag into thirds. Sew the handle on to the bag as shown in photos. Make sure you do not twist the handle as you sew it on.

Sew on the snap to the inside of the flap and onto the front of the bag so they are lined up.
